Transaction 81aa95e15b0185cf384ed6ec50e26596db52d7bf42054586c01eee3c4939528c
1 Input
1 Output
-
81aa95e15b0185cf384ed6ec50e26596db52d7bf42054586c01eee3c4939528c:0
- value
- 38764
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ff45a2ca3b37f72a44061f2cb818354fcfadd83
- address
- bc1qtl695t9rkdlh9fzqv8evhqvr2n704hvrj3w27r